A battery is made up of an anode, cathode, separator, electrolyte, and two current collectors (positive and negative). The anode and cathode store the lithium. The electrolyte carries positively charged lithium ions from the anode to the cathode and vice versa through the separator. The movement of the lithium ions creates free ...
WebSince the wire is made of a conductive material, such as copper, its constituent atoms have many free electrons which can easily move through the wire. However, there will never be a continuous or uniform flow of electrons within this wire unless they have a place to come from and a place to go. WebA liquid can only conduct electricity if it has free ions because ions are the charge carriers there, there are no free electrons in water. However, because of the polar nature of the water molecule (moving into the realm of chemistry here), adding an acid or a base forms the ions required for conduction (H3O+ and OH- respectively).
